Transaction 9015eb995b80c32589a5de7d76c491f6888e79a085e1a9b1fb64ad7bfc6d1d1e

1 Input
2 Outputs
  • 9015eb995b80c32589a5de7d76c491f6888e79a085e1a9b1fb64ad7bfc6d1d1e:0
  • value  3791911
    address  33fqvVkD3yHLWcero8pxY3Gyrvwr9yyJpy
  • 9015eb995b80c32589a5de7d76c491f6888e79a085e1a9b1fb64ad7bfc6d1d1e:1
  • value  1190169
    address  1Q6Qsrz6cnNnUd2SDcFNCQCorRaXZjg2jZ